Course programme
This course is designed for beginners and will be based on the human figure. Traditional materials such as clay, wax and plaster will be used with modelling and casting of the figure and head.

Materials and School Shop
Easels, boards, printing inks and some sculpture materials are provided but students are expected to supply any additional materials needed. The School Shop stocks a range of art materials at reasonable prices.
